Contemporary homes in subdivisions
Housing in the Big Creek area of Cumming is largely made up of new traditional and Craftsman-inspired homes built between 2000 and today. Popular exterior design choices include brick facades, two-car garages and recessed entryways with columns. These spacious homes often have four and five bedrooms and sit on lots with well-kept lawns and trimmed landscaping. Many single-family residences are adorned with mature oaks and maples common to the area. They most commonly cost between $600,000 and $700,000, though more modest homes start around $500,000. The area does have some condos, townhouses and apartments, especially within 55+ communities like the Gatherings at Herrington.Recreation at Sharon Springs Park and Big Creek Greenway
“We have all kinds of parks in Forsyth County. The Big Creek Greenway is hugely popular,” says Cherie Edmunds, Forsyth County local and Realtor at Century 21 Results. Big Creek Parkway has 9 miles of paved paths running along Big Creek. Sharon Springs Park offers a spectrum of outdoor recreation, including eight tennis courts, eight baseball fields and batting cages, basketball courts, soccer fields and a walking trail. For an immersive outdoor experience, locals can visit Caney Creek Preserve. This 63-acre preserve has a forested walking path along a creek, as well as faux-rock climbing structures and a dog park.South Forsyth County Schools earn A’s across the board
Several highly rated public elementary schools serve the area, and students may attend Big Creek Elementary School or Sharon Elementary School, which earned A-plus and A grades from Niche, respectively. Older students progress to A-rated Piney Grove Middle School and A-plus-rated South Forsyth High School. South Forsyth High School offers a variety of rigorous academic programs, including the International Baccalaureate Diploma Programme and dual enrollment at Lanier Technical College.Swimming on Lake Lanier and events in the nearby mountains
Less than 10 miles northeast of the Big Creek Area, Lake Lanier, the largest lake in Georgia, has opportunities for swimming, boating, and fishing and hosts events like the annual Fourth of July fireworks at Mary Alice Park. The nearby North Georgia Mountains offer opportunities for weekend excursions. “There are dozens of wineries in the mountains. There’s also hiking, cute small towns, and festivals. There’s all kinds of fun. There are so many festivals, like the Georgia Apple Festival in Ellijay. We’re also in very close proximity to Dahlonega. They have the Gold Rush Days festival in the fall and Bear on the Square festival in the spring,” Edmunds says.Within driving distance of the mountains and city
Big Creek, in South Forsyth County, is a car-dependent area about 35 miles northeast of Downtown Atlanta and 50 miles southwest of the North Georgia Mountains. Northside Forsyth Hospital is only about 4 miles northeast of the Big Creek area. “The healthcare system is a big employer, and it’s a draw for families and older people,” Edmunds says. Lower property taxes and exemptions also attraction people to Forsyth County: “In Cumming and in many of the counties around here, we have a senior exemption on taxes. Once you’re at a certain age you no longer pay the school tax, so your taxes go down exponentially,” Edmunds says.Big box stores and shopping at the Collection at Forsyth
“More and more retail shops and restaurants are coming in,” Lawrence says. “The area is growing and expanding.” The Big Creek area residents have access to plenty of nationally known chains, including Walmart Supercenter, Publix and Chick-fil-A. At The Collection at Forsyth shopping mall, locals catch a movie at the AMC theater, pick up the latest best-seller at Barnes & Noble, or go dress shopping at Versona boutique. For dining out, residents head to the beach-themed Ocean & Acre restaurant at the Halcyon mixed-use development for locally sourced seafood. Hobnob Tavern is the go-to spot for bourbon and burgers. “It has a fun vibe,” Lawrence says. “They have karaoke and trivia nights.”
